Pepperdine Drops 73-34 Decision to Portland
Feb. 9, 2013 VIDEO HIGHLIGHTS No Wave scored more than six points. Kelsey Brockway (Rolling Hills, Calif./Palos Verdes HS), Bria Richardson (Hawthorne, Calif./Serra HS) and Monet McNally (Santa Clarita, Calif./L.A. Baptist HS) each scored six points for Pepperdine. Pepperdine shot a frigid .177 (11-62) from the field and attempted 31 field goals each half. The Waves went just 1-for-18 from 3-point range (.056). The Pilots sizzled offensively, connecting on .441 (26-59) and finished the second half connecting on .556 (15-27) after the intermission. Portland converted 22 Wave turnovers into 25 points, while Pepperdine scored just nine points of 20 Pilot miscues. Jasmine Wooton scored a game-high 16 points, Kari Luttinen added 15 points and Alexis Byrd chipped in 13 to lead Portland.
